DESCRIPTION:No. 57218
Mineral:Forsterite var. Peridot (gem-grade crystal)
Locality:Suppat, Naran-Kagan Valley, Kohistan District, Khyber Pakhtunkhwa (North-West Frontier Province), Pakistan
Description:Terminated gem-grade transparent green peridot crystals, the green gem variety of the mineral species forsterite, with rounded outer surfaces. Internally the peridot has clean termination zones that could produce several small faceted gemstone. Weight: 8.3 grams
Overall Size:21x17x12 mm
Crystals:6-21 mm
